## Deployment

The Thornquist crossword generator deploys as a single container behind the Bramblegate proxy. Release candidates are built from the main branch, tagged, and promoted after the puzzle-quality regression suite passes. Dictionary bundles ship separately and must match the generator's declared version. Rollbacks are handled by redeploying the previous tag. The production instance runs with the following configuration.

config for kawif-hahig:
zorix:
  log_level: error
  metrics_host: metrics.zorix.lumiclabs.internal
  pool_size: 16

UserSplit Cutover Drift: the extracted account service and the legacy Marigold monolith user module are reporting divergent record counts during dual-write. This fires when drift exceeds 0.5% over 15 minutes. New team members should not replay writes manually. Reconciliation steps and the rollback procedure are documented on the internal page.

wiki page, tajog-fafog: https://gitlab.paliqsys.corp/dash/display/job/853dd6fcbf54

# Security notes: the planner runs under a read-mostly service account; writes are
# limited to the `restock_orders` table. Route optimization is computed in-process,
# so no machine location data leaves this host. Telemetry older than 90 days is
# purged by the retention job defined further down. Credentials are injected at
# deploy time and should never be committed here. The planner connects to the
# inventory database using the string below.

warehouse DSN: mssql://rusdor_svc:0FSWCn9@db-951a.paliqforge.local:5432/ulawyn